Stewart Milne Timber Systems bolsters growth with north-west appointment

6 February 2014


Stewart Milne Timber Systems has appointed John Cain to manage its business development activities in north-west England.

Previously a sales manager for Robertson Timber Engineering's English division, Mr Cain will lead Stewart Milne Timber Systems' push in the region where it has worked on several projects in the last few years, including its Adelphi development in Preston as part of the AIMC4 consortium.

Mr Cain has more than 15 years of experience across the construction sector, ranging from windows and doors to joinery and timber frame. He also has extensive senior management experience, having been regional sales director at Anglian Building Products and northern sales manager for Speed Frame PVCu.

On top of his experience in sales, Mr Cain has a strong background in partnering with clients to deliver value engineered solutions. Having already worked with timber frame in his most recent position, he appreciates the advantages this construction method can offer customers.

Eddie Stanton, sales director for Stewart Milne Timber Systems, said: "We're experiencing significant growth at the moment and we were looking to appoint someone who could develop this in a key area for us.

"John's previous sales experience, particularly in the timber frame industry, will be helpful for us as we set out our stall for growth. The growth in the construction market is presenting significant opportunities for us as a company and the appointment of John will enhance our ability to respond."
